General description
Kinetics of gas-phase reactions of ozone with 1-chloro-3-methyl-2-butene was studied. Reaction of 1-chloro-3-methyl-2-butene with potassium iodide in acetone and sodium ethoxide in ethanol was studied.
Application
1-Chloro-3-methyl-2-butene was used in total synthesis of geraniol.
